Left for me alone, I would have fired Wike from PDP – Dele Momodu
Publisher of Ovation magazine, Dele Momodu has said that he would have expelled Nyesom Wike, current Minister of the Federal Capital Territory (FCT) from the Peoples Democratic Party (PDP) if he had the power.
Appearing on a Channels Television program on Tuesday, September 5, Momodu described Wike as an ‘’unruly” person who wants to destroy PDP.
He said;
“I don’t have the power, if I had the power I would have fired him (Wike) long ago. Such an unruly person who wants to destroy our party? One individual cannot hold everybody to ransom.”
